The petitioner has filed the instant writ petition for quashing of Mill Attachment List and order contained in Memo No. 516 dated 20.08.2016 issued by the District Co-operative Officer, Katihar whereby the names of rice millers of Katihar district have been attached against the Primary Agriculture Credit Co-operative Society Limited (for short 'PACCS')/ Trade

Patna High Court CWJC No.7225 of 2016 (7) dt.21-08-2018 2/3 Division. The petitioner has further prayed for directing the respondents to prepare a fresh Mill Attachment List according to their milling capacity as per direction of the Principal Secretary, Co-operative Department.

Learned counsel appearing for the Bihar State Food and Civil Supplies Corporation submitted that the Government of India has fixed cut off date of procurement of paddy from 05.12.2015 to 31.03.2016 and received custom milled rice upto 30.06.2016. By letter dated 02.12.2015 issued under the signature of Principal Secretary, Co-operative Department, Government of Bihar, detailed work projects/guidelines were issued for procurement of custom milled rice for the year 2015-16 through PACCS/Trade Divisions. Thereafter, in pursuance of the direction of the Chief Secretary as well as Managing Director of the Bihar State Food and Civil Supplies Corporation, six rice millers were attached with PACCS and Trade division wise and a provisional Mill Attachment List contained in Memo No. 1698 dated 23.12.2015 was issued by the Bihar State Food and Civil Supplies Corporation, Katihar. He contended that the Mill Attachment List was prepared for the year 2015-16 and the period has already expired and in that view of the matter, the writ petition has become infructuous.

Patna High Court CWJC No.7225 of 2016 (7) dt.21-08-2018 3/3 In view of the submissions made above, the writ petition is dismissed as infructuous.
